    Ramps For Wheelchairs at Home

    Ramps for wheelchairs that are at home are an excellent option for any family with a person who uses the wheelchair or scooter. They permit them to easily move around their house and to go out into the community.

    The buying process is straightforward when a few key elements are taken into account such as slope, length and style. The right ramp to purchase will ensure it is safe and secure for use.

    If you have a loved one who is using a wheelchair having ramps in your home can make it much easier for them to get around obstacles. There are a variety of ramps available that include temporary or permanent ones. The best option for 1109278.xyz you will depend on the specific circumstances and surfaces where you plan to use them. You should also think about the slope, weight capacity, and safety features like side rails or nonslip surfaces. You can speak with accessibility experts and healthcare professionals to help you choose the right ramps.

    Portable ramps are typically made of lightweight materials, which makes them easy to transport or lift. They can also be folded when not in use, making them ideal for transport and storage. They feature a gradual slope that allows wheelchairs to overcome obstacles or height variations such as stairs or curbs. They can be used indoors as well as outdoors, and many come with safety features to help prevent accidents and falls.

    Portable ramps are available in local accessibility equipment stores, medical supply shops, and online solution providers. You can also check out the options available in hardware or construction shops that sell mobility equipment. They often have a variety of ramps that can be used for different purposes. Local disability associations are an excellent source for ramps, as they have many connections and partnerships with manufacturers and suppliers that can provide price-competitive pricing.

    If you want your ramp to meet ADA standards, ensure that it's compliant with current accessibility guidelines. It should be 36 inches wide to accommodate wheelchair wheels as well as other ADA-compliant items, like handrails. Look for ramps that have a smooth surface and is compatible with your wheelchair or scooter. If you're required to drive your van while the ramp is in place, choose a telescoping wheelchair ramp that can be retracted or extended to meet the height of your vehicle requirements.

    Modular ramps are an excellent option for homes as they can be broken down into sections that can be assembled on site. Aluminum is used to make them, as it provides the strength and durability you need without losing the lightness. There are ramps that are modular with a textured surface which aids in traction, as well as a toe guard for additional security. If you're looking for more permanent option, you can opt for a concrete or wood ramp. These are typically constructed on-site and you'll probably need a building permit to construct them. They're ideal when you don't want take on the burden of fixing or replacing damaged ramps.

    If You are Planning to Use a Ramp Temporarily

    If you are planning to use your wheelchair ramp for a short period of time, like during recovery from an injury or surgery and you need a temporary, portable ramp that folds up is the best choice. This type ramp can be set up easily at a curb or doorway to assist you with getting into your vehicle or walk over a step at home. It is lightweight and folds up for easy transportation. This is a great choice if you are planning to travel with your mobility device. It is possible to carry it along wherever you go.

    Semi-permanent ramps can be a good alternative for those who do not intend to use the ramp for a long time. These are a little different than ramps that are portable in that they typically come with a tongue and groove system to connect the sections of the ramp to one another. This allows them to be disassembled and reassembled quickly. Aluminum is typically employed, making them tough and impervious to weather. They typically come with a one-year warranty. Modular ramps are available in various lengths and have a wide variety of slopes to suit various needs.

    Conditions of Long-term or Progressive Recovery

    Semi-permanent ramps are the best option for homes that need ramps for wheelchairs for a longer time. They are more durable than temporary ramps because they are meant to be used for a longer duration of time. They're generally more expensive than portable and temporary ramps, but they offer solid, durable solutions for your mobility scooter or wheelchair to use when needed.

    If you're in search of an permanent ramp that can be installed in your home, you should consult an skilled home modification contractor. They can assist you in determining the type of ramp that is suitable for your requirements and ensure that it complies with local codes and ADA guidelines. They can also provide you with financial options to buy an permanent ramp. This could include a reverse or home improvement mortgage, or state-based disability grants. You'll be able to avoid any unexpected costs. You can also check with your local government whether they can assist you in modifying your house for accessibility.
